At the end of a path, leading straight to the countryside and its tranquility, an old farm dating from the end of the 18th century was completely renovated in 2007 by the architect B. Fourcade. On one level, the configuration of this quality renovation follows an L-shaped plan. In this green, relaxing setting with no overlooked vis-à-vis, the building is bathed in light. All the living rooms are resolutely turned towards the outside thanks to large bay windows favoring an opening onto nature and the swimming pool. In a dominant position, the house embraces nature as far as the eye can see and offers various perspectives, including a Romanesque church emerging in the distance. Beautiful volumes and materials such as the stone of the original farm and wood enhance the entrance and the living space bringing together the kitchen, the dining room and the living room. In its extension, the master suite with shower room and WC and the office offers real independence. Separated by the living room with a wood stove and the equipped kitchen, a second night area offers 4 bedrooms and a bathroom with shower and separate toilet. Outside, large partly covered terraces take advantage of the salt-treated swimming pool on the 7100m2 plot. A wood shed, a workshop and a cellar adjoining the house complete this rare property on the market.
